fork download
  1. #include <iostream>
  2. #include <cstdio>
  3. using namespace std;
  4.  
  5. int main() {
  6. int t, n, x, b, s, min;
  7. scanf("%d", &t);
  8. while(t--) {
  9. scanf("%d %d", &n, &x);
  10. s=0; min=101;
  11. while(n--) { scanf("%d", &b); s=s+b; if(b<min) min=b; }
  12. if(min<=s%x) printf("-1\n");
  13. else printf("%d\n", s/x);
  14. }
  15. return 0;
  16. }
Success #stdin #stdout 0s 3300KB
stdin
3
4 7
10 4 8 5
1 10
12
2 10
20 50
stdout
-1
1
7